Transaction 99159a934e119db246863b0a8b247818849c04cb2dc89ab1c281cd88fcabeb42
1 Input
1 Output
-
99159a934e119db246863b0a8b247818849c04cb2dc89ab1c281cd88fcabeb42:0
- value
- 351353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d00bed7982700797046744a57b4e424c95fc0bba OP_EQUAL
- address
- 3Lf4mC3A9vB5X636oec4gmVAfiqVSfKM6X